Output de66d21d192703fe9e5b300a1e9475932b158b5d366774a7343e8c7a7a60426b:0

value
3326401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84029b0818c2d017dd325095ee23589cf43d6ac7 OP_EQUAL
address
MKwAYnrxeyvN5ScKYCxfd3VrFji5shMJWq
transaction
de66d21d192703fe9e5b300a1e9475932b158b5d366774a7343e8c7a7a60426b
spent
true